The Return of Sailor Moon

Episode Number: 41    Season Num: 2    First Aired: Wednesday November 22, 1995    Prod Code: n/a
The Sailor Scouts have lost all memory of the fight against Queen Beryl. They don't even remember each other or that they were the Sailor Scouts. Now they can live their lives as normal teens until a new evil bestoes itself upon Tokyo: The Doom Tree with two aliens named Alan and Ann. The Doom Tree is losing energy so Alan and Ann want to collect energy from the people of Earth to keep the Doom Tree alive. The Earth needs its protector, Sailor Moon once again. So Luna gives Serena back her memory. Once Sailor Moon is back, she starts to miss Darien and the other Sailor Scouts because they still don't remember their identities. Will Sailor Moon be able to fight this new villan by herself??

Trivia

add »
The Alan and Ann Saga did not exist in the original Manga storyline. This was added to the Anime version in order to help keep the Manga ahead of the Anime. This not only includes Alan and Ann but also both the Doom Tree and the Moonlight Knight as well. (edit)
